The Backstory:
Lynn grew up doing band and chorus in her small town in Western Massachusetts and attended UMass Amherst to study flute performance and music education. She shared her junior recital as a flutist with oboist Rebecca Thomson under the guidance of Christopher Krueger, and she performed on piccolo across the United States and Canada with the UMMB under the direction of George Parks.
Upon college graduation she got a job teaching music in the public schools and found herself without much time or energy to make her own music as she poured herself into what others needed of her in the full time role as well as her many side hustles (camps, small group and private lessons, etc). She eventually realized she missed identifying as a musician but didn't want to jump back into the Western Classical Music world she left behind in college. She tried doing the coverband thing as a second vocalist, but playing in bars late at night wasn't what she was chasing. Finally, after nearly a decade's hiatus, she has settled on only accepting gigs that resonate with her values and interests, and has resumed making music for her soul and to share her soul with others.
